Acknowledgements

My thanks this time go mainly to Margaret Brown for her usual help in the initial reading here, and for the final typing. To Jean Cowper and Jim Shearer for their assistance with some of the outstanding flat stones and in the checking. Jim has waxed poetic again, it must be something in the air up there. A number of people have asked where the churchyard is at Tyrie, so to help you find it there is a map, taken from the OS Sheet 30. This also pinpoints some of the other churchyards in the area. On our last visit to check on a stone we found a new one had been erected, so that has been included at 96a. The sunshine, so hard to see up hear this year, was kind to us that morning and we were able to read the Nos 36 and 37 where, before that, we had no inscription. Thanks from all of us go to the Alexandra Hotel in Fraserburgh again, where we spent the holiday weekend, and were well looked after. Sheila M. Spiers.
